在开发大型TypeScript项目时,合并多个文件以创建单个输出文件是一项常见的任务。这不仅有助于优化加载时间,还能使代码更易于维护。本文将详细介绍如何轻松掌握代码合并技巧,并教你如何高效合并TypeScript文件。
合并TypeScript文件的必要性
- 优化加载时间:合并多个文件可以减少HTTP请求次数,从而缩短页面加载时间。
- 提高代码可维护性:将相关代码合并到一个文件中,有助于提高代码的可读性和可维护性。
- 减少项目复杂性:合并文件可以简化项目的文件结构,降低项目复杂性。
合并TypeScript文件的常用方法
使用tsc命令行工具
TypeScript自带了命令行工具tsc,它可以方便地合并多个文件。以下是使用tsc命令行工具合并TypeScript文件的基本步骤:
- 打开命令行工具。
- 切换到包含TypeScript文件的目录。
- 使用以下命令合并文件:
tsc -d output.js file1.ts file2.ts file3.ts
上述命令会将file1.ts、file2.ts和file3.ts合并到output.js中。
使用第三方工具
除了使用tsc命令行工具,还可以使用第三方工具如tslint、typescript-formatter等来合并TypeScript文件。以下是一些常用的第三方工具:
- tslint:一款TypeScript代码风格检查工具,可以将多个文件合并为一个代码检查报告。
- typescript-formatter:一款TypeScript代码格式化工具,可以将多个文件合并为一个格式化后的文件。
使用IDE或编辑器
许多流行的IDE和编辑器都支持TypeScript代码合并功能。以下是一些常见的IDE和编辑器:
- Visual Studio Code:通过安装
tslint、typescript-formatter等扩展,可以方便地合并TypeScript文件。 - WebStorm:内置了TypeScript支持,可以直接合并文件。
高效合并TypeScript文件的小技巧
- 使用合适的命名规范:为合并后的文件命名一个简洁、有意义的名称,方便日后维护。
- 合理组织代码结构:合并后的文件应保持良好的代码结构,以便于阅读和理解。
- 避免代码重复:在合并文件之前,检查是否存在代码重复,以减少文件大小。
总结
掌握代码合并技巧对于TypeScript开发者来说非常重要。通过本文的介绍,相信你已经对如何高效合并TypeScript文件有了清晰的了解。在实际开发过程中,灵活运用这些技巧,可以让你在项目管理和代码维护方面更加得心应手。
